    Sensei Michael Radermacher Upgraded to National Kumite Referee A

    Ishinryu Karate Australia is proud to announce that Sensei Michael Radermacher has been upgraded to National Kumite Referee A. This is the highest level of national refereeing accreditation in Australia. He now holds top-level status in both kumite and kata, having already achieved the rank of National Kata Judge A.
